1. Introduction to Sunscreen Swimsuits

As the sun shines brighter and beach outings become more frequent, the necessity for effective sun protection intensifies. Sunscreen swimsuits are meticulously designed garments that provide an additional layer of defense against harmful ultraviolet (UV) rays. These specialized swimsuits integrate fabric with built-in UV resistance, offering protection while maintaining the comfort and style typical of traditional swimwear. Traditionally, the primary means of sun protection has been topical sunscreen, but integrating protective clothing into your swimwear routine is an innovative solution. Many consumers are unaware that sunscreen swimsuits can significantly reduce the risk of sunburn and long-term skin damage. 2. Benefits of Sunscreen Swimsuits

One of the most significant advantages of wearing sunscreen swimsuits is their ability to provide long-lasting protection against UV rays. Unlike topical sunscreens, which require reapplication every few hours, a swimsuit designed for UV protection offers continuous coverage as long as you wear it. This can be particularly advantageous for individuals engaged in water sports or beach activities, where frequent reapplication can be cumbersome. Additionally, many sunscreen swimsuits are designed with breathable and quick-drying materials, ensuring that wearers stay comfortable during their activities. Another important benefit is the prevention of skin cancers and other sun-related illnesses, as these garments help to significantly reduce exposure to harmful rays. Furthermore, the stylish designs available today mean that you don't have to sacrifice fashion for protection.

3. Key Features to Look For

When selecting sunscreen swimsuits, there are several key features that should be considered to ensure optimal protection and comfort. First and foremost, look for the UPF (Ultraviolet Protection Factor) rating of the fabric. A UPF rating of 50+ is generally considered excellent, blocking out about 98% of UV radiation. In addition to UPF ratings, consider the material composition; swimsuits made with polyester or nylon typically offer better UV resistance. It is also crucial to check for coverage options—including long sleeves, high necklines, and full bodied suits—for enhanced protection. Comfort is another critical factor; breathable, stretchy materials will improve wearability, particularly when engaging in physically demanding activities. Lastly, consider additional features such as moisture-wicking properties, which keep the wearer dry and comfortable, further enhancing the experience.

5. Care Tips for Longevity

To maximize the lifespan of sunscreen swimsuits, proper care and maintenance are essential. Always follow the manufacturer’s care instructions; typically, this includes washing in cold water and avoiding bleach and softeners, which can break down the fabric's protective properties. It is advisable to hand wash your swimsuit to protect the fibers and maintain its integrity. After swimming, particularly in saltwater or chlorinated pools, rinse your swimsuit immediately to remove any chemicals that can accelerate wear. When drying, avoid direct sunlight; instead, lay it flat or hang it in a shaded area to prevent fading. Lastly, storing swimsuits in a cool, dry place will help prevent mildew and deterioration, ensuring that your investment remains in top condition for many seasons.
